Core Daily Habits That Set Escapees Apart

Several key habits repeatedly appear among individuals who live independent, liberated lives. Incorporating these into your day can help you join their ranks.

1. Morning Centering Rituals

Starting the day grounded and intentional is a hallmark of escapees. Whether it’s meditation, journaling, or setting clear intentions, these rituals prime the mind for focused autonomy and decision-making.

2. Prioritized Goal Setting

True escapees break larger visions into achievable daily goals. Prioritizing what truly matters aligns actions with purpose, prevents overwhelm, and ensures progress toward long-term freedom.

3. Intentional Time Blocking

Managing time purposefully is critical. Escapees use time blocking to protect core work periods and personal activities, fostering deep work and minimizing distraction-driven drift.

4. Continuous Learning

Growth-minded escapees dedicate daily time to learning—reading, listening to podcasts, or engaging in skill-building. This habit fuels adaptability and innovation, essential traits for navigating uncertain paths.

5. Physical Movement and Health Focus

Maintaining physical vitality is non-negotiable for true escapees. Regular movement, exercise, and mindful nutrition habits energize the body and mind, supporting sustained autonomy.

6. Digital Boundaries

Escapees guard their attention fiercely, limiting social media and email consumption to purposeful windows. This preserves mental energy and prevents external noise from hijacking focus.

7. Reflection and Adjustment

At day’s end, true escapees reflect honestly on their wins and challenges. This habit nurtures self-awareness, highlights lessons, and informs adjustments for future days, fueling continual growth.

Overcoming Challenges to Establish These Habits

Even the most motivated individuals encounter roadblocks such as time scarcity, fatigue, and distractions. Successful escapees overcome these by:

  • Starting small and building habits incrementally.
  • Using accountability systems or communities.
  • Prioritizing self-care to maintain energy.
  • Adapting habits when life circumstances shift.
  • Celebrating progress and learning from setbacks.
